Justin Najmy

Justin Abraham Najmy BA ( born April 23, 1898 in Aleppo, Syria, † June 11 1968 in the USA) was the first Apostolic Exarch of the United States, and a bishop of the Melkite Greek Catholic Church.

Life

On 25 December 1926, dedicated to Justin Abraham Najmy to the religious priest of the Basilian Aleppinischen (BA). He was sent to the United States and worked as a pastor at St. Basil the Great in Central Falls. The appointment as Patriarchal Exarch of the United States, with simultaneous appointment as Titular Bishop of Augustopolis in Phrygia he received on 27 January 1966. Archbishop Athanasios Toutoungi of Aleppo consecrated him, together with the co-consecrators Archbishop Maximos V. Hakim and Archbishop Paul Achkar, on 29 May 1966 Bishop. Under his leadership, the Church of the Annunciation was built in a suburb of Boston. He died on June 11, 1968 following a sudden heart failure and was buried in the parish cemetery of the Church of St. Basil the Great in Cumberland (Rhode Iceland ). He was succeeded by Archbishop Joseph Elias Tawil.
